Remote Immobilisation
Remote immobilisation lets you cut a vehicle's ability to move by sending a command from AVLView. You manage it from Settings > Remote Immobilisation.

How to immobilise or mobilise a vehicle
- Go to Settings > Remote Immobilisation to see the device table.
- Check each immobiliser's arm status, signal, and battery.
- Choose Immobilise or Mobilise for the vehicle you want to control.
- Confirm the action in the confirm dialog to send the command.
What the device table and detail view show
- Arm status — whether each immobiliser is Armed or Unarmed.
- Signal — the device's connection strength.
- Battery — the device's battery level.
- Safety Verification Test — available in a device's detail view to confirm the immobiliser is wired and responding correctly.
- Activity log — a record of immobilise and mobilise commands for the device.
Safety checks prevent activation while the vehicle is moving, so an immobilise command will not take effect on a moving vehicle.
Frequently asked questions
Is any hardware required before I can use remote immobilisation?
Yes. A certified technician must first wire an immobiliser relay into the vehicle's ignition or fuel circuit. Remote immobilisation will not work until this hardware is installed.
Can I immobilise a vehicle while it is driving?
No. Built-in safety checks prevent activation while the vehicle is moving.
